Canada's international transactions in securities, November 2025

Foreign investors added $16.3 billion of Canadian securities to their holdings in November, following a significant investment of $46.6 billion in October. Meanwhile, Canadian investors acquired $16.5 billion of foreign securities in November, more than offsetting the divestment of $11.6 billion in October.

As a result, international transactions in securities generated a marginal net outflow of funds of $161 million from the Canadian economy in November, after a significant inflow of funds of $58.2 billion in October.
